Contraction of The Pupils
A physiological response where the pupils decrease in size, typically in response to increased light exposure or during focus on near objects.
Empathy
The skill of recognizing and sympathizing with another person's feelings.
Facial Feedback Effect
The hypothesis that facial movement can influence emotional experience, suggesting that the act of smiling can make one feel happier.
Behavior Feedback Effect
The Behavior Feedback Effect describes how the outcomes of behaviors can influence an individual's future attitudes and actions, creating a feedback loop.
